Manners for Using Cellphones A cellphone always generates weak electric waves while its power is ON. Be considerate of others and the environment around you, and have fun using your cellphone safely. In some places, the use of cellphones is prohibited. • Do not use cellphones while you are driving. Doing so is dangerous and also forbidden by law. • Be sure to turn your cellphone OFF before you board airplanes. The use of cellphones onboard airplanes is forbidden by law. Consider where to use your cellphone and be careful of how loudly you talk. • Do not make calls in cinemas, theaters, museums, libraries and other similar places. Turn your cellphone OFF or set it to the manner mode to prevent others around you from being inconvenienced by ring tones for incoming calls or mail. Electric waves from cellphones may adversely influence medical devices and equipment. • People with a pacemaker may be close to you in crowded places such as trains. Turn your cellphone OFF in such places. • Abide by the instructions of hospitals and other medical institutions where it is forbidden to use or carry cellphones. • When on a crowded street, use your cellphone in places where you do not prevent others from passing. • When on a train or in a hotel lobby, move to areas where you will not bother others around you. • Take care not to talk too loudly during conversations. • Get permission from persons who will appear in photos or movies before you shoot photos or movies of others with your cellphone. 1

Beware of Junk Mail and One-Ring Calls! If you receive junk mail… Using the mail filter function, you can reject mail sent from specific addresses or mail that bears “未承諾広告※(Unsolicited Ad)” in the title, which is the biggest source of junk mail. The following mail functions are available for preventing arrival of junk mail. • “未承諾広告フィルター” : Rejects 未承諾広告 (Unsolicited Ad) mail. “アドレスフィルター” : Rejects mail sent from specified addresses. • “指定受信設定” : Accepts only mails sent from specified addresses. “指定拒否設定” : Rejects mails sent from specified addresses. • • → Page 48 If you receive a call from an unknown number… It may be a “One-Ring Call” intended to trick you into calling back and accessing unwanted pay programs. Disaster Bulletin Board Service About Disaster Bulletin Board Service When a big scale disaster occurs, you can register your safety information through EZweb. The registered safety information can be referred from anywhere in Japan through EZweb or Internet. Registering safety information Referring to the safety information   ◆When a big scale disaster occurs, from au cellphone, you can register your safety information such as your condition or comments to the “ 災害用伝言板 (Disaster Bulletin Board)” created on the EZweb. ◆ After the registration of your safety information, you can notify by E-mail your family or acquaintances you have previously designated that you registered your safety information on the “ 災害用伝言板 (Disaster Bulletin Board)”. ◆You can refer to the safety information of the person you want to know about by entering the phone number of the person from EZweb or Internet*. * When you refer to the safety information from other carriers’ cellphone (except for TU-KA), PHS or personal computer, you can refer to it from http://dengon.ezweb.ne.jp/.
